Assessing Lawyer Expenses: What You Ought to Learn
How can individuals guarantee they are making informed decisions when assessing attorney fees? Comprehending the fee structure is vital. Attorneys may bill hourly rates, flat fees, or retainer fees, each with distinct implications for the total cost. Individuals should inquire about what services are included in the fee and whether additional costs, such as filing fees or administrative expenses, may arise.
Comparing fees from multiple attorneys is crucial, but the lowest price may not always represent the greatest worth. It's vital to consider the attorney's expertise, reputation, and track record alongside their charges. Additionally, people should ask about payment plans or financing options to ease monetary strain. Openness is essential; a trusted attorney will offer a detailed outline of costs and answer questions without hesitation. Ultimately, sound choices result from comprehensive investigation and frank dialogue regarding fees and work performed.

Costs and Payment Structure
It is important to understand the charges and fee system when choosing an immigration attorney. Clients should inquire into the attorney's fee arrangements, including whether they charge hourly or offer flat fees for particular services. Clarifying which services are covered in the quoted fees and whether any extra charges, such as filing fees or administrative expenses, apply is also key. Clients should ask about payment plans, retainer agreements, and how billing is handled. Transparency about fees can avoid misunderstandings and unexpected financial issues later. Often Asked Questions
What is the standard timeframe for the copyright procedure?
The copyright procedure typically requires between multiple months through several years, depending on multiple considerations such as the kind of petition, nation of residence, and current processing times at immigration departments.
What Are the Risks of Managing Immigration Issues Without an Attorney?
Managing immigration issues without an lawyer can lead to confusion, postponements, and potential denials. People may overlook important deadlines, overlook necessary documentation, or misinterpret legal requirements, eventually jeopardizing their chances of achieving favorable results.
Is It Possible to Change Immigration Lawyers While a Case?
Yes, individuals can change immigration attorneys mid-case. However, it's crucial to assess potential interruptions and delays in the process. Proper communication and documentation are vital to ensure a smooth changeover between attorneys.
What might I undertake if My Application Is Denied?
If an application is denied, the individual should carefully review the denial notice, determine why it was rejected, gather necessary documentation, and consider reapplying or appealing the outcome within the given time period to increase odds of approval.
How Can I Get Ready for My Attorney's Consultation?
To prepare for an legal professional's meeting, an person should collect relevant documents, list important inquiries, and note important details about their case. This groundwork improves dialogue and ensures a fruitful conversation about immigration matters.
